Just got back from our trip a week ago and finally went through the charges. We went the 3rd week of August when Free Dining was not offered and we opted not to purchase the plan. We wound up breaking even with the plan price,however we got to eat what we wanted not what DP tells you to have. We originally had quite a few character meals, buffets, and TS planned. We ended up cancelling some because we weren't eating as much and split some meals as well. Had we kept them in, then we would have been over the cost of the DP. I'm happy to find out that we did well without the DP and it was a learning experience for next time.

If you add exactly what you're getting on the dining plan, it usually comes out a better value....if you eat like that and it's not too much food.

If we went and only bought 1 or 2 snacks a day, and spread out our meals and paid OOP we could probably come out cheaper than the dining plan. But, when we add up snacks, QS credits, TS credits and refillable mug for 6 the dining plan is always a better value.

Again, it really only works out if you eat like this at home, which we usually eat 2 full meals and a lighter meal at home as well so this does work out for us. Having it pre-paid is a bonus for our family as well....one less thing I have to worry about :)
